Latest Patents

Zumbrum's latest patents reflect his commitment to advancing fluid transfer methodologies. One notable invention is the "Fluid Transfer Assembly," which comprises one or more fluid conduits integrated into a body portion that defines a fluid channel. This design allows the body portion to elongate between 150 percent to 1500 percent without breaking, facilitating the removal of a mandrel from the fluid conduit. Another significant invention is the "System for Simultaneous Distribution of Fluid to Multiple Vessels." This system features an input tube linked to several vessels through a distribution hub, ensuring that an equal portion of fluid is distributed to each vessel via individual inflow conduits.
